Adani Group’s Ambuja Cements has announced the acquisition of Andhra Pradesh based Penna Cement Industries Ltd for Rs 10,422 crore. The deal includes the purchase of 100% shares from the current promoters, P Pratap Reddy and family. The acquisition will expand Ambuja’s market presence in South India and reinforce its position as a pan-India leader in the cement industry.
